Output 86a743ce19da9b1761708fffeb4717ff9c4daf6f07ada914f5e05f8a23e1be29:0

value
1015091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ebe79c76bdd251a26578c21760aee560dcd41d OP_EQUAL
address
33nDPiFknV3rp8TuY31f9zcVaoLki55zsd
transaction
86a743ce19da9b1761708fffeb4717ff9c4daf6f07ada914f5e05f8a23e1be29
confirmations
374174
spent
true